Fondazione Penta Onlus
The Penta Foundation provides ethical, regulatory and legal oversight and guidance on all aspects of the EMPIRICAL project, throughout Work Package 5 activities. Safety and compliance with agreed principles, standards and codes of practice will be closely monitored and ethics, regulatory and legal requirements at each recruitment site will be applied overall the duration of the trial.
The close collaboration with HerpeZ Limited Zambia and the University of Zimbabwe will allow for the provision of tools to facilitate the accomplishment of all the ethics, regulatory and legal requirements mentioned above. All these activities are aimed at ensuring the welfare and the protection of the rights of children participating in the EMPIRICAL clinical trial.
About Penta
The Penta Foundation was set up in May 2004 as the Penta coordinating centre to support activities related to research on HIV and other paediatric diseases, primarily infectious diseases. Penta’s activities address a complex range of concerns, such as proposal drafting, scientific coordination, project implementation and data management. The Foundation is a promoter/sponsor of clinical trials according to the GCP guidelines and relevant European Directives; a centre for project development and management and for the collection and dissemination of information on HIV related issues.
Due to its unique expertise in running international research projects, the Foundation has established several links with research groups in order to manage EU and other funded projects (also beyond paediatrics) thus getting additional support for its infrastructure. It also coordinates training programmes for health providers.
The Penta Foundation has led more than 15 clinical trials in HIV-infected children in the past 25 years. Penta works with experts on regulatory and ethical issues to ensure the conduct of high quality clinical research and training. The activity of Penta ID network, which brings together key stakeholders, acts as an important support for communication and dissemination activities.
